This Will Be: Natalie Cole's Everlasting Love finds Cole continuing her trawl through traditional pop standards. This time, the production has a slight contemporary bent, and she decides to expand her reach to the Beatles' "Lucy in the Sky with Diamonds," but the heart of the album remains with songs like "Sophisticated Lady" and "Inseparable." Cole's phrasing and singing is improving with each of these songbook albums, yet This Will Be simply isn't as fresh and engaging as the first of these excursions, Unforgettable. Still, fans of that record will find this nearly as entertaining. ~ Rodney Batdorf, All Music Guide
